Falcon Heavy launch now set for April 11, 6:35 pm Eastern
Capitalism in space: SpaceX has pushed its Falcon Heavy launch back to tomorrow, April 11, at 6:35 pm pm (eastern) tonight.
No reason yet on why. The live stream is embedded below the fold, and will be available here when the launch happens.
